Usual Product Packaging Machine Issues



Packaging makers, like any complex machinery, can run into a range of typical problems that may hinder their performance and effectiveness - packaging machine repair. One common problem is irregular sealing, which can bring about product wasting and wastefulness if plans are not effectively secured. This usually results from misaligned components or used securing aspects


One more frequent concern is mechanical jams, which can take place as a result of foreign items, used components, or inappropriate alignment. Jams can trigger delays in production and increase downtime, eventually affecting general efficiency. Furthermore, digital malfunctions, such as failure in sensing units or control systems, can lead and disrupt procedures to incorrect dimensions or irregular maker actions.


Moreover, issues with product feed can also arise, where things may not be supplied to the product packaging location regularly, causing disruptions. Wear and tear on belts and rollers can lead to suboptimal performance, needing instant focus to avoid more damages.


Comprehending these common concerns is essential for preserving the integrity of product packaging procedures, ensuring that machinery runs efficiently and effectively, which subsequently aids in meeting manufacturing targets and maintaining product high quality.

Troubleshooting Techniques



Effective repairing strategies are essential for immediately addressing problems that occur with product packaging makers. A methodical method is important for identifying the origin of malfunctions and lessening downtime. Begin by gathering details about the symptoms observed; this might include uncommon noises, functional delays, or mistake codes shown on the machine's user interface.


Next, refer to the maker's manual for fixing guidelines particular to the model in question. This source can give important insights right into typical issues and suggested diagnostic steps. Utilize visual assessments to examine for loosened connections, used belts, or misaligned components, as these physical variables often contribute to functional failures.


Carry out a procedure of elimination by screening private equipment features. For instance, if a seal is not forming appropriately, examine the sealing system and temperature setups to identify if they fulfill functional specs. File each action taken and the results observed, as this can help in future repairing initiatives.


Fixing vs. Substitute Decisions





When faced with tools malfunctions, making a decision whether to replace a product packaging or repair maker can be a complex and essential choice. This decision rests on several crucial aspects, consisting of the age of the device, the extent of the damage, and the projected effect on functional performance.


To start with, consider the equipment's age. Older equipments may require more frequent repairs, leading to higher advancing expenses that can surpass the financial investment in a new unit.


Operational downtime is one more critical factor to consider. If fixing the device will certainly trigger extended delays, buying a new maker that offers improved efficiency and reliability may be extra sensible. Take into consideration the availability of components; if replacement parts are difficult to come by, it may be much more tactical to change the maker completely.


Inevitably, doing a cost-benefit analysis that consists of both immediate and lasting ramifications will aid in making an informed choice that aligns with your financial constraints and operational goals. (packaging machine repair)
